Megosztás a következőn keresztül:


New-AzADSpCredential

Kulcs-hitelesítő adatokat vagy jelszó-hitelesítő adatokat hoz létre egy szolgáltatásnévhez.

Syntax

New-AzADSpCredential
   -ObjectId <String>
   [-StartDate <DateTime>]
   [-EndDate <DateTime>]
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   -ObjectId <String>
   [-StartDate <DateTime>]
   [-EndDate <DateTime>]
   -CertValue <String>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   -ObjectId <String>
   -KeyCredentials <MicrosoftGraphKeyCredential[]>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   -ObjectId <String>
   -PasswordCredentials <MicrosoftGraphPasswordCredential[]>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   [-StartDate <DateTime>]
   [-EndDate <DateTime>]
   -CertValue <String>
   -ServicePrincipalObject <IMicrosoftGraphServicePrincipal>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   [-StartDate <DateTime>]
   [-EndDate <DateTime>]
   -ServicePrincipalObject <IMicrosoftGraphServicePrincipal>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   [-StartDate <DateTime>]
   [-EndDate <DateTime>]
   -CertValue <String>
   -ServicePrincipalName <String>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   [-StartDate <DateTime>]
   [-EndDate <DateTime>]
   -ServicePrincipalName <String>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   -PasswordCredentials <MicrosoftGraphPasswordCredential[]>
   -ServicePrincipalObject <IMicrosoftGraphServicePrincipal>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   -PasswordCredentials <MicrosoftGraphPasswordCredential[]>
   -ServicePrincipalName <String>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   -KeyCredentials <MicrosoftGraphKeyCredential[]>
   -ServicePrincipalObject <IMicrosoftGraphServicePrincipal>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zADSpCredential
   -KeyCredentials <MicrosoftGraphKeyCredential[]>
   -ServicePrincipalName <String>
   [-DefaultProfile <PSObject>]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

Description

Kulcs-hitelesítő adatokat vagy jelszó-hitelesítő adatokat hoz létre egy szolgáltatásnévhez.

Példák

1. példa: Kulcs hitelesítő adatainak létrehozása a szolgáltatásnévhez

$credential = New-Object -TypeName "Microsoft.Azure.PowerShell.Cmdlets.Resources.MSGraph.Models.ApiV10.MicrosoftGraphKeyCredential" `
                                 -Property @{'Key' = $cert;
                                 'Usage'       = 'Verify'; 
                                 'Type'        = 'AsymmetricX509Cert'
                                 }
New-AzADSpCredential -ObjectId $Id -KeyCredentials $credential

Kulcs hitelesítő adatainak létrehozása a szolgáltatásnévhez

2. példa: Jelszó hitelesítő adatainak létrehozása a szolgáltatásnévhez

Get-AzADServicePrincipal -ApplicationId $appId | New-AzADSpCredential -StartDate $startDate -EndDate $endDate

Jelszó hitelesítő adatainak létrehozása a szolgáltatásnévhez

Paraméterek

-CertValue

Az aszimmetrikus hitelesítő adattípus értéke. Ez az alap 64 kódolású tanúsítványt jelöli.

Típus:String
Position:Named
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-Confirm

Jóváhagyást kér a parancsmag futtatása előtt.

Típus:SwitchParameter
Aliasok:cf
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-DefaultProfile

Az Azure-ral való kommunikációhoz használt hitelesítő adatok, fiók, bérlő és előfizetés.

Típus:PSObject
Aliasok:AzContext, AzureRmContext, AzureCredential
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-EndDate

A hitelesítő adatok használatának érvényes záró dátuma. Az alapértelmezett záródátumérték a mai naptól számított egy év. Aszimmetrikus típusú hitelesítő adatok esetében ezt az X509-tanúsítvány érvényességének dátumára vagy azt megelőzően kell beállítani.

Típus:DateTime
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-KeyCredentials

a szolgáltatásnévhez társított kulcs hitelesítő adatai.

Típus:MicrosoftGraphKeyCredential[]
Position:Named
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-ObjectId

Az alkalmazás objektumazonosítója.

Típus:String
Aliasok:Id, ServicePrincipalObjectId
Position:Named
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-PasswordCredentials

A szolgáltatásnévhez társított jelszó hitelesítő adatai.

Típus:MicrosoftGraphPasswordCredential[]
Position:Named
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-ServicePrincipalName

A szolgáltatásnév neve.

Típus:String
Aliasok:SPN
Position:Named
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-ServicePrincipalObject

A szolgáltatásnév objektum használható folyamatbemenetként.

Típus:IMicrosoftGraphServicePrincipal
Position:Named
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:True
Helyettesítő karakterek elfogadása:False

-StartDate

A hitelesítő adatok használatának tényleges kezdő dátuma. Az alapértelmezett kezdő dátumérték ma van. Aszimmetrikus típusú hitelesítő adatok esetében ezt az X509-tanúsítvány érvényességének dátumára vagy azt követően kell beállítani.

Típus:DateTime
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-WhatIf

Bemutatja, mi történne a parancsmag futtatásakor. A parancsmag nem fut.

Típus:SwitchParameter
Aliasok:wi
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

Bevitelek

IMicrosoftGraphServicePrincipal

Kimenetek

IMicrosoftGraphKeyCredential

IMicrosoftGraphPasswordCredential

Jegyzetek

ALIASOK

New-AzADServicePrincipalCredential